Output 74fbeb228c68eba1f571a8e46f69304601b513e93ad3a63432ff2dd2e0216398:3

value
41375095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c3faced709d314fdc5a49bc59d7e644ff35c7f OP_EQUAL
address
MQUFK4Vg7QXaoCt8QstyEULyG9ZfNByKhJ
transaction
74fbeb228c68eba1f571a8e46f69304601b513e93ad3a63432ff2dd2e0216398
spent
true